OT's Role in Health Promotion

The path to health and well-being is intricately linked to participating in daily occupations. Occupational therapy focuses on enabling clients to maximize their capacity to participate in life activities that are important and meaningful to them, to promote overall health and wellness.

SPD in Adults

Adolescents and adults who received and benefited from therapy in childhood may nonetheless find themselves struggling when they reach new developmental levels and/or life experiences. For example, a teenager who has adapted to the challenges of high school may leave home for college and find that living in the more chaotic setting of a dormitory triggers new symptoms. At times like these, "booster" therapy or counseling that increases self-understanding and provides strategies for adapting to the new situation is often extremely helpful.
